Directions:

  1. This tea is best made a day or so ahead of time.
  2. Place tea bags and fresh mint sprigs in container in which you are going to steep tea.
  3. Boil 8 cups of water and pour over the tea bags and the mint.
  4. Let tea bags and mint steep as long as you can - I try to leave them in for a couple of hours.
  5. Remove tea bags and mint from container, squeezing tea bags to get all remaining tea from them.
  6. Add pineapple juice, defrosted juice concentrates and water; refrigerate.
